The Durham Miners Gala is a mass celebration of the coal mining and Trade Union heritage of the North-East. It is held annually, having taken place nearly every year since 1871. http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Durham_Miners'_Gala This shows Old Elvet jam packed with crowds awaiting the parade. Distinguished guests are waiting on the balcony of the County Hotel on the left side of the road.
